Many businesses begin with informal processes.
Employees learn by observing coworkers.
Knowledge is shared through conversations.
Experienced team members simply "know" how things get done.
While this approach may work for a small organization, it becomes increasingly difficult to maintain as the business grows.
Without documented procedures, organizations often experience inconsistent results, longer training times, operational errors, and unnecessary dependence on individual employees.

Why Standard Operating Procedures Matter
Standard Operating Procedures are more than written instructions.
They establish a consistent framework for how work should be performed across the organization.
Effective SOPs help businesses:
Deliver consistent customer experiences. Reduce operational errors. Improve employee productivity. Support compliance initiatives. Simplify onboarding and training. Preserve institutional knowledge.
As organizations expand, documented procedures become an essential component of operational excellence.
Consistency is difficult to achieve without a shared standard.
Document Processes Before They Become Problems
Many organizations wait until an experienced employee leaves before realizing how much knowledge was never documented.
Instead, SOPs should be developed proactively.
Begin by documenting processes that are:
Performed frequently. Business critical. Customer facing. Highly regulated. Dependent on specialized knowledge. Shared across multiple departments.
Capturing this information early reduces future disruptions while creating a stronger operational foundation.
Focus on Clarity and Usability
An SOP is only valuable if employees actually use it.
Effective procedures should be:
Easy to understand. Clearly organized. Written using consistent terminology. Supported by visuals where appropriate. Accessible to employees when needed.
Avoid unnecessary technical language or overly complicated documentation.
The goal is to provide practical guidance that employees can confidently follow in their daily work.
Standardize Without Eliminating Flexibility
Not every business situation follows the same path.
Well-designed SOPs establish standard practices while allowing room for professional judgment when appropriate.
For example:
Routine transactions may follow a defined workflow. Escalation procedures may include decision guidelines. Customer service processes may offer approved alternatives for resolving unique situations.
Balancing consistency with flexibility helps organizations maintain quality without limiting employee problem-solving.
Improve Training and Onboarding
As businesses grow, efficient onboarding becomes increasingly important.
Documented procedures reduce the time required for new employees to become productive by providing:
Step-by-step instructions. Defined responsibilities. Business rules. System usage guidance. Process maps. Frequently asked questions.
Rather than relying exclusively on experienced coworkers, organizations provide new team members with a reliable reference that supports independent learning.
This shortens learning curves while improving confidence and consistency.
Support Continuous Improvement
Standard Operating Procedures should not remain static.
Business processes evolve as:
Customer expectations change. Technology improves. Regulations are updated. New products and services are introduced. Organizations identify better ways of working.
Regular reviews help ensure procedures remain accurate and aligned with current business objectives.
Employee feedback is especially valuable during these reviews, as the people performing the work often identify practical opportunities for improvement.
Continuous improvement keeps SOPs relevant and effective.
Strengthen Governance and Compliance
Many organizations operate in environments that require documented procedures.
Scalable SOPs help support governance by clearly defining:
Required approvals. Documentation standards. Security responsibilities. Compliance checkpoints. Record retention practices. Quality control measures.
Documented procedures also make audits more efficient by demonstrating that consistent operational standards are in place.
Governance becomes part of the workflow rather than an afterthought.
Align SOPs with Technology
Modern business processes frequently involve multiple software applications.
SOPs should reflect how employees interact with technology by documenting:
System responsibilities. Data entry standards. Integration points. Automated workflow steps. Exception handling. Reporting requirements.
Keeping documentation aligned with current technology helps employees understand not only what they should do, but how business systems support the overall process.
Measure the Effectiveness of Your SOPs
Organizations should evaluate whether documented procedures are producing measurable improvements.
Useful performance indicators include:
Reduced onboarding time. Fewer process errors. Improved compliance. Faster task completion. Higher employee confidence. Greater process consistency. Reduced customer issues.
Monitoring these metrics helps determine when procedures should be refined to support changing business needs.
